In "The Times They Are A'changin'," two young comic fans learn the hard way that bragging about a sold-out issue can backfire—especially when Everett, a sharp-eyed collector with a knack for the unexpected, quietly steers their story with just a look. Written by Tony Isabella and illustrated by Ed Wesolowski and Gary Dumm, this 1986 gem captures the subtle tension between fandom and reality, with inks by Wesolowski and Dumm adding depth to the moment.
